Inspection Date: 5/13/2025
Inspection #: Visit ID: 8844590
- 36-32-5:Basic - Ceiling/ceiling tile shows damage or is in disrepair. Observed small holes throughout kitchen area.
- 13-03-4:Basic - Employee with no hair restraint while engaging in food preparation.
- 35B-01-4:Basic - Exterior door has a gap at the threshold that opens to the outside. Back door.
- 23-03-4:Basic - Nonfood-contact surface soiled with grease, food debris, dirt, slime or dust. Hood vents above cook line.
- 02D-01-5:Basic - Working containers of food removed from original container not identified by common name. Observed sugar,salt and msg in unlabeled containers by the cook line. Observed flour, sugar in containers by back door.
- 14-31-5:High Priority - Nonfood-grade bags used in direct contact with food. Observed beef in deep freezer.
- 41-17-4:Intermediate - Spray bottle containing toxic substance not labeled. Observed on shelving next to front counter.
Inspection Date: 7/30/2024
Inspection #: Visit ID: 8722509
- 14-01-5:Basic - Bowl or other container with no handle used to dispense flour and sugar. Manager removed containers during inspection.
- 08A-17-6:High Priority - Raw animal foods not properly separated from one another based upon minimum required cooking temperature when stored in a freezer - not all products commercially packaged. Observed raw chicken stored over raw shrimp in reach in freezer at storage area.
- 03F-10-5:Intermediate - No written procedures available for use of time as a public health control to hold time/temperature control for safety food. Observed no written procedures for egg rolls 61F and fried chicken 79F held on time. Time mark displays 11:00-3:00. Provided manager with Time as a Public Health Control Form during inspection.
Inspection Date: 3/22/2024
Inspection #: Visit ID: 8592195
- 14-01-5:Basic - Bowl or other container with no handle used to dispense food. In rice and corn starch bins. Removed and replaced with scoop with handle. Corrected On-Site
- 23-24-4:Basic - Buildup of food debris/soil residue on equipment door handles. Upright freezer near front counter. Repeat Violation
- 14-45-4:Basic - Cardboard used to line nonfood-contact shelves. Card board lining all dry storage shelves. Operator discarded cardboard during inspection. Corrected On-Site
- 24-05-4:Basic - Clean glasses, cups, bowls, plates, pots and pans not stored inverted or in a protected manner. Metal bowls on clean dish rack not inverted. Operator inverted bowls at time of inspection. Corrected On-Site
- 25-32-4:Basic - Reuse of single-service or single-use articles. Oyster sauce can reused as scoop in rice bin. Can discarded at time of inspection. Corrected On-Site
- 14-31-5:High Priority - Nonfood-grade bags used in direct contact with food. Crab Rangoon stored in plastic grocery bag. Operator transferred crab Rangoon to food grade bag at time of inspection. Corrected On-Site
- 03A-02-5:High Priority - Time/temperature control for safety food cold held at greater than 41 degrees Fahrenheit. On cook line counter: fried chicken 67F, egg rolls 69F, per operator approximately 2 hours. Placed in each in freezer during inspection. Fried chicken 56F, after 30 mins. **Corrective Action Taken**
- 22-02-4:Intermediate - Food-contact surface soiled with food debris, mold-like substance or slime. Food inside grinder. Grinder dismantled and placed in sink for washing.
- 16-37-1:Intermediate - No chemical test kit provided when using sanitizer at three-compartment sink/warewashing machine or wiping cloths. Establishment requires chlorine test strips.
Inspection Date: 1/16/2024
Inspection #: Visit ID: 8344772
- 23-24-4:Basic - Buildup of food debris/soil residue on equipment door handles. Observed buildup of food debris on handles for two reach in coolers and one reach in freezer at kitchen area.
- 08B-49-4:Basic - Employee personal food not properly identified and segregated from food to be served to the public. Observed employees personal food unidentified and not segregated from food service items at kitchen reach in cooler.
- 12A-09-4:High Priority - Single-use gloves not changed as needed after changing tasks or when damaged or soiled. Observed employee prepare takeout order then rinsed gloves with water from the pot filler into a pan at cook line then closed takeout box to serve to customer.
- 02C-03-5:Intermediate - Commercially processed ready-to-eat, time/temperature control for safety food opened and held more than 24 hours not properly date marked after opening. Observed bins of chicken with no date mark in reach in cooler at front counter. Per manager chicken has been held since 01-11-24.
- 03F-10-5:Intermediate - No written procedures available for use of time as a public health control to hold time/temperature control for safety food. Observed bins of eggs rolls and breaded chicken at cook line held on time with no written plan for time as a public health control. Provided operator with Time as a Public Health Control Form during inspection.
